The advent of technology has significantly transformed various industries, and the maritime sector is no exception. One of the most fascinating innovations in this field is the development of the automated ship, a vessel designed to operate with minimal human intervention. This advancement not only promises to enhance efficiency but also aims to improve safety on the seas. In this essay, I will explore the concept of the automated ship, its benefits, challenges, and potential impact on the future of maritime transport.An automated ship is equipped with advanced technologies such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, and sophisticated sensors that allow it to navigate, control, and manage operations autonomously. These vessels can process vast amounts of data in real-time, making decisions based on environmental conditions, cargo requirements, and navigational hazards. The integration of automation in shipping has the potential to reduce human error, which is a leading cause of maritime accidents. According to statistics, more than 70% of maritime incidents are attributed to human mistakes. By minimizing the need for crew members, automated ships can significantly decrease the likelihood of accidents caused by fatigue or misjudgment.Moreover, automated ships can lead to substantial cost savings for shipping companies. With fewer crew members required onboard, operational costs related to wages, training, and accommodations can be reduced. Additionally, these vessels can optimize fuel consumption through precise navigation and route planning, further lowering expenses. This economic advantage could make shipping more competitive, especially in an industry that often operates on thin profit margins.However, the transition to automated ships is not without its challenges. One major concern is the regulatory framework surrounding autonomous vessels. Currently, international maritime laws are primarily designed for manned ships, and adapting these regulations to accommodate automated ships will require significant collaboration between governments, industry stakeholders, and maritime organizations. Ensuring compliance with safety standards and liability issues will be crucial as these vessels become more prevalent.Another challenge lies in the technology itself. While advancements in automation are promising, there are still limitations to consider. For instance, automated ships may struggle in complex environments, such as busy ports or during adverse weather conditions. The ability to make judgment calls in unpredictable situations remains a significant hurdle for AI systems. Therefore, a hybrid model that combines automation with human oversight might be more effective in the short term, allowing for a gradual transition towards fully autonomous operations.The societal implications of automated ships also warrant consideration. As these vessels become more common, the demand for traditional seafaring jobs may decline, leading to job displacement for many skilled workers in the maritime industry. It is essential for policymakers to address these concerns by investing in retraining programs and creating new opportunities in technology and maintenance sectors related to automated shipping.In conclusion, the emergence of the automated ship represents a significant leap forward in maritime technology. While the benefits of increased efficiency, safety, and cost savings are compelling, the challenges of regulation, technology, and workforce impact cannot be overlooked. As we move towards a future where automated ships play a pivotal role in global trade, it is crucial to strike a balance between innovation and the socio-economic factors at play. Only then can we fully harness the potential of this groundbreaking advancement in the shipping industry.
